.elementor-31171 .elementor-element.elementor-element-85ce7d8{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;}.elementor-31171 .elementor-element.elementor-element-ea78f7a{text-align:center;}.elementor-31171 .elementor-element.elementor-element-ea78f7a .elementor-heading-title{color:#D51616;font-family:"Signature Photograph", Sans-serif;font-size:80px;font-weight:500;}.elementor-31171 .elementor-element.elementor-element-e944c31{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--background-transition:0.3s;}.elementor-31171 .elementor-element.elementor-element-160d07b .gallery-item .gallery-caption{display:none;}.elementor-31171 .elementor-element.elementor-element-160d07b .gallery-item{padding:0 5px 5px 0;}.elementor-31171 .elementor-element.elementor-element-160d07b .gallery{margin:0 -5px -5px 0;}@media(min-width:768px){.elementor-31171 .elementor-element.elementor-element-e944c31{--width:95%;}}/* Start custom CSS */.gallery-columns-3 .gallery-item {
    max-width: 49%;
    max-width: -webkit-calc(50% - 4px) !important;
    max-width: calc(50% - 4px) !important;
}

#gallery-1 .gallery-item {
    float: left;
    margin-top: 10px;
    text-align: center;
    width: 50% !important;
}/* End custom CSS */
/* Start Custom Fonts CSS */@font-face {
	font-family: 'Signature Photograph';
	font-style: normal;
	font-weight: normal;
	font-display: auto;
	src: url('https://bonbonup.fancydreams.es/wp-content/uploads/2024/11/Photograph-Signature.ttf') format('truetype');
}
/* End Custom Fonts CSS */